The Leasing Consultant position at Metropolitan Riverwalk is a pivotal role focused on maximizing property occupancy by actively engaging with prospective residents and providing outstanding customer service. Working under the supervision of the Community Manager, the Leasing Consultant plays a critical role in generating qualified traffic through strategic marketing initiatives and community networking. This role demands proactive outreach, excellent communication skills, and the ability to create lasting impressions that encourage lease signings and resident retention.

Leasing Consultants serve as the community's first point of contact, warmly welcoming potential residents and guiding them through property tours to showcase the unique features and benefits of living at Metropolitan Riverwalk. Beyond direct resident interactions, the Leasing Consultant supports retention efforts by addressing resident concerns, coordinating communications, and helping to create an inclusive and engaging environment through social media and local partnerships. The role involves scheduling appointments, processing lease applications, qualifying residents, and maintaining an organized office environment by assisting with administrative tasks under the direction of the Community Manager.
